DODIK BACKS TRUMP'S PEACE COMMITTEE PROPOSAL
BANJALUKA, JANUARY 22 /SRNA/ – SNSD President Milorad Dodik has supported the initiative of US President Donald Trump to establish a Peace Committee, describing it as an effort to return politics to its fundamental purpose - peace, stability, and the protection of the interests of peoples, rather than the interests of various global bureaucracies and lobbying structures that have lived off other people’s crises for years without resolving a single one.
Dodik pointed out that Republika Srpska has long witnessed how, under the guise of so-called multilateralism, a network of quasi-institutions has operated not in the service of peoples, but as instruments of pressure where sovereignty was punished, electoral will annulled, and democratically elected leaders labeled simply because they refused to bow to defeated ideologies. He stressed that this is why Trump’s message from Davos carries particular weight - that the world must stop being held hostage by deranged bureaucracies and activist apparatuses, and that states must regain the right to protect their borders, constitutional order and their people. "This is not a threat to anyone - it is a return to reality," Dodik wrote on the social media platform X. Dodik added that Europe today appears lost in its own hypocrisy. "For decades, they lectured us on law and democracy, while supporting agendas of imposed ideologies, the dismantling of tradition, the destruction of Christian and family foundations of society, and the persecution of any politician or state that dared to say - enough is enough," Dodik stated. He added that it was easy for them to play by the rules while power was exclusively in their hands, but now, as the world changes and global powers return to politics based on interests and reality, they suddenly invoke principles they were the first to violate. "Republika Srpska knows very well what it means when others `interpret democracy` for you and `arrange society` on your behalf. That is why we understand and support every effort to return the world to common sense - peace through strength, stability through sovereignty, and the freedom of peoples to decide their own future," Dodik emphasized.
